A man who is looking for a relationship thinks differently than a man looking for companionship.

If you are wondering why he isn’t calling to set up the next date, or why he is texting to see if you want to “hang out,” then you’re missing the fact that he likes you but he’s not falling for you.

A relationship-ready man will drive the relationship forward. He will pursue you for a relationship and will want to claim you. He will push for exclusivity. He will not be ambiguous in his behavior because when he thinks you are “The One” he won’t want to give another guy the opportunity to take you away from him.

Women nest, they plan, they prepare, they make sure there’s a backup of almond milk in the cupboard. A man only hunts when he’s hungry.

It’s important that you don’t make things easy for the guy you want a relationship with. We are not suggesting that you play hard to get or be inauthentic. Instead understanding how a man thinks will align you with how he sees his woman – as the prize!

A man prizes what he earns and has to work for.

If you make things convenient for him – calling to ask him out, making all the plans, texting often to see how he is doing – then you leave the door open for the convenient guy to hang around way too long.

The convenient guy is happy to have your company, to share emotional intimacy, and to get regular sex, however, he is not interested in any kind of long-term commitment. He’s just going with the flow and whatever is easy he will happily go along with.

Leave space for a man to pursue you and you’ll never have to wonder what his intentions are.

He probably can’t label his emotions, but he does know how he feels about you.

Ask a man how he feels and he may give you a blank stare. Understanding how a man thinks is very different from being in touch with his emotional life. He likely prioritizes his thinking state and doesn’t spend much time labeling his emotions.

So ask a man what he thinks and he will gladly share with you (and you may find out about how he feels in the forthcoming conversation).

It’s not that men aren’t emotional. It’s just they generally aren’t as in touch with their emotions as you are. It doesn’t mean that he doesn’t feel deeply.

Understanding how a man thinks and differentiates his thoughts from his feelings allows you to talk across the brain. You can share with him how you feel, and then ask him what he thinks.

A man will know how he feels about you. He may not always be able to express it clearly with words, but his actions will tell you all you need to know.

Paying attention to a man’s actions will inform you about his values.

He wants to feel useful.

A man likes to try to solve your problems because he wants to feel useful. Men develop a lot of their self-esteem by their actions and their accomplishments.

Just because he is offering his opinion on how you should handle a situation in your life doesn’t mean he thinks you are incapable. Quite the contrary! Understanding how a man thinks will inform you that offering you suggestions is his way of being helpful. Solving your problems is one of the ways he feels useful to you.

A man who cares about you doesn’t want you to struggle. When he hears about your difficulties at work or with a friend, he is looking for an opportunity to see a problem that he can fix.

Understanding how a man thinks differently from your female friends will encourage you to ask him to simply listen. If you don’t want suggestions from him about how to handle the situation you’re sharing about ask him for what you need instead. Make a request before you share what is going on that you would like him to listen and that you need to speak with someone you trust.

Let him know how he can be useful and you will feel supported by him and emotionally connected to him.

He is wired to be efficient.

Because men have traditionally been the hunters and the earners, they will focus their energy on the task at hand. Women are great at multitasking and men are great at focusing their energy.

He will also conserve his energy to be ready for the next hunt or task.

So many women are doing too much in their relationships and they don’t understand why their man isn’t stepping up to reciprocate. Understanding how a man thinks will clear this common problem up quite easily.

Men are not wired to reciprocate. If he sees that a task is being accomplished, his mind thinks it would be inefficient to help. He sees you as capable and will assume you’ve got it handled.

Stepping back will leave space for him to help out, or a direct request for assistance. When women do more they inadvertently inspire him to do less.

Understanding how a man thinks will let you know that if you need him to do something you’ll need to spell it out for him and say it. When he does what you ask then acknowledge and appreciate him. This will inspire him to step up and be your hero.
